------- Additional comments from [EMAIL PROTECTED] Tue Nov 1 11:27:00 -0800 2005 ------- When using OOo_2.0.0rc1_050923_Win32Intel_install_de.exe on Windows 98 for importing version 1.x standalone base forms in sxw files by copy & paste the controls get inserted in a fresh .odb file internal form each on it's own new form named standard. To reproduce: 1. open a registered .odb file 2. open a .sxw standalone form working on the same datasource 3. switch the old form in design mode 4. select all controls by mouse or in the form navigator 5. select "copy" from toolbar 6. switch to the new form in the .odb file 7. select "paste" from the toolbar In the form navigator the hirarchy looks similar to this: forms standard label1 standard textfield1 standard label2 standard imagecontrol1 and so on, although all controls have been in the one and only form named "standard" in the source file. --------------------------------------------------------------------- Please do not reply to this automatically generated notification from Issue Tracker.
